Plugin authors should know that Bucketeer hashes subject IDs deterministically per experiment, so repeated calls are stable unless the salt rotates. The rotation job runs nightly; plugins must not cache assignments longer than the rotation window. Devon, please keep the plugin sandbox pinned to the staging allocator until the v4 contract lands, since external hooks read the allocator weights directly. For reference, the current staging configuration values are listed below.

service settings:
PRAWYN_PIN=9848
PRAWYN_METRICS_HOST=metrics.prawyn.lumicworks.corp
PRAWYN_LOG_LEVEL=warn
PRAWYN_TENANT=pelius

## Connection pool limits

Every service at Wrenfall that talks to the Oakmire database cluster goes through the shared pooler. Pools are sized per service, not per instance, so scaling out replicas does not raise your total connection budget. Exceeding the budget queues requests rather than opening new connections; long queue waits page the owning team. If you need more headroom, file a quota request. Current defaults are listed below.

tuning constants:
QUOTAS = {
    "druwyn": 5,
    "holix": 5,
    "zorath": 5,
    "holwyn": 10,
}

CI note — Brindlewood hermetic migration. So we finally moved the Copperjack build off the shared toolchain. Things to know: the new sandbox forbids network fetches, so anything that quietly downloaded a schema at build time will now fail loudly — that's intentional, vendor the file. The old cache keys are useless; purge them or you'll chase ghost mismatches for a day like I did. Reproducibility checks pass on two clean machines. If you need to verify you're on the hermetic path, check the token below.

session token of bahip-hawep = htk4_b0c1

### Step 6: Canary Gating

Promotion of a Brightmoor canary past the 10% stage requires all three gates to pass: error budget, latency SLO, and saturation check. The release manager confirms gate status in the Ledgerline dashboard before approving. Approval produces a promotion manifest that must be signed, or the rollout controller will halt the deploy. Sign the manifest using the key below.

rollout seal: bky19_M1Zvn1YQwEBTy4XxP3H